    Resolution: Rejected


This is not a bug that 'suddenly' appeared in 3.1.0.CR1, but a feature that has existed for the last 5 or 6 years.
For tld's versions 1.2 and 2.0, form for tag shows attributes and variables in tables that display in columns all values of interest; and button edit is available for editing attribute or variable object. For tld 2.1 it was decided to display attributes in tree since they have more values than is convenient to display in the table.
